‘Lankayam Shankari Devi……… starts the Sloka of Ashta Dasha Shakti Peethas, written by Sri Jagadguru Aadi Shankaracharya. Shankari Devi temple in Tricomalee, Srilanka is a prominent temple for Hindus. But, it is most rarely visited and it is very least popular in all AstaDasha Shakti peethas. There is no information available about Shankari Devi even in internet. Shanakri Devi Temple is situated in an east coast town of Srilanka, Tricomalee (Tri – Cona – Malai = a triangular hill). Along with the temple of Shaankari Devi, there is a temple of Lord Shiva – TRIKONESHWARA Temple. Portuguese people demolished these temples in 17th century.
